LSBDC to hold seminar in Hammond on starting, financing a small business
Tuesday, September 8, 2015
by: Tonya Lowentritt
HAMMOND – The Louisiana Small Business Development Center (LSBDC) at Southeastern
Louisiana University, the Greater Hammond Chamber of Commerce, and SCORE will host
a free seminar designed to help individuals interested in starting a business.
The seminar, titled “Starting and Financing Your Business Idea,” will take place
in Hammond on Tuesday, Sept. 22, from 9 a.m. to noon at the Southeast Louisiana Business
Center located at 1514 Martens Drive.
“This workshop is highly recommended for all individuals interested in determining
the feasibility of their business ideas and for those planning to start or who have
recently started a small business. It would also be helpful for anyone seeking a small
business loan or wanting to learn more about business planning,” said Sandy Summers,
assistant director of the Small Business Development Center.
Topics to be covered include writing a business plan, sources of funds for start-up
and expansion, small business resources, and required licenses.
